Singapore
English
Etymology
From Malay Singapura, from Sanskrit सिंहपुर (siṃhá-pura), from सिंह (siṃha, “lion”) + पुर (pura, “city”).
Pronunciation
- (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ˈsɪŋəpɔː/, /sɪŋəˈpɔː/
- (General American) IPA(key): /ˈsɪŋəpoɹ/
- (Singapore) IPA(key): /siŋaˈpɔ/
- (dated) IPA(key): /ˈsɪŋɡəpɔː(ɹ)/, /sɪŋɡəˈpɔː(ɹ)/
Audio (US) (file)
Proper noun
Singapore
- An island and city-state in Southeast Asia, located off the southernmost tip of the Malay Peninsula; a former British crown colony. Official name: Republic of Singapore.
